Online therapeutic massage courses are
available through several colleges and universities for students
interested in becoming certified massage therapists. Though additional
hands-on training must still be completed, students can complete the
required classroom study by enrolling in online courses.
Overview of Online Therapeutic Massage Courses
Massage therapists use their knowledge of human physiology and
massage to treat their clients. Online therapeutic massage courses are
provided online for students pursuing a career as a certified
massage therapist.
Though clinical experience is required for all therapeutic massage
programs, some coursework can be completed online. Graduates usually
work alongside other health care professionals in hospitals, nursing
homes, chiropractic clinics, rehabilitation centers and health spas.
Course Requirements
Through the use of instructional DVDs, medical terminology flashcards
and online exams, distance learning therapeutic massage courses provide
students with the same materials and information as a traditional
program.
Practicing techniques on friends and family allows students hands-on
experience before they begin their 200 hours of on-site training. When
questions arise, students can use the Internet to contact their
instructors and classmates for assistance.
List of Online Therapeutic Massage Courses
Introduction to Therapeutic Massage Course
This course provides students with an overview of
massage therapy,
the health benefits of therapeutic massage and the careers available
for massage therapists. Swedish massage, sports massage, aromatherapy
and reflexology are just some of the different types of therapeutic
massages introduced in this online course. Understanding the techniques
and uses of these massages is essential to becoming a successful massage
therapist.
Anatomy and Physiology Course
Each therapeutic massage technique is linked to a specific part of
the human anatomy. Massage therapists must understand how each technique
affects the muscular, circulatory, respiratory, digestive, nervous,
skeletal and immune systems. This online course provides students with
training on human anatomy and physiology to enhance their understanding
of the application and effects of each massage technique.
Ethics and Management Course
It is essential for students to have extensive knowledge of state
ethical and legal guidelines for massage therapists. A proper
understanding of informed consent, confidentiality and professional
boundaries helps protect therapists and their clients. Due to the
physical interaction between the client and the therapist through the
use of massage, students must know how to handle potential ethical
dilemmas that may occur during treatment. This online course requires
students to identify and become familiar with ethical and legal
guidelines for massage therapists.
